"Several beneficiary schemes will be launched for the personnel and their families," Home Secretary B Prasada Rao said.
Rao said this while inaugurating a Fuel Station set up near the Camp Office of the 3rd Battalion of the APSP in Kakinada near here.
"Kakinada people will now get pure petrol and diesel with accurate measurement from this modernised fuel station and without any adulteration," he said.
Rao said income generated through sales from the station will be utilised to provide infrastructural facilities in APSP battalion camps besides using it for the benefit of families of the personnel living in the colony.
